    OSCE Expert Report: Russians Systematically Indoctrinate, Militarize Ukrainian Children

    An OSCE expert mission found that Russia's treatment of Ukrainian children may involve systematic indoctrination and militarization, potentially violating international humanitarian and human rights law. The report calls for enhanced accountability and child protection measures.

    Lawyer raises concern over regulatory gaps in Nigeria’s surrogacy practice

    A lawyer in Nigeria has expressed concerns about regulatory gaps in surrogacy practices, urging future legislation to prioritize child protection, recognition of parentage, protection of surrogate mothers, and transparency in assisted reproductive arrangements.

    Faced with growing outrage, French government presents new measures for child protection

    The French government announced new measures to improve child protection and handle sexual assault cases after growing public outrage over the handling of a girl's killing. The justice minister faces calls to resign amid the controversy.

    Namibia: City Sounds Alarm Over Angolan Street Kids

    The City of Windhoek in Namibia has raised urgent concerns about child protection and law enforcement related to groups of Angolan migrant children living, trading, and begging on the city's streets for the past three years.

    The EU thinks Meta isn't doing enough to protect children

    The European Union is investigating Meta, alleging the company is failing to adequately protect children on its platforms Instagram and Facebook. A preliminary probe found Meta's measures to keep minors off these services are insufficient.
